Color reaction of m-acetylchlorophosphonazo and nickel(II)

Qing-Zhou Zhai

Abstract

In pH 6.8 triacid (phosphoric acid, acetic acid, boric acid)-NaOH buffer medium, nickel (II) and m-acetyl-chlorophosphonazo (CPAmA) form a 1:3 blue complex. At the maximum absorption wavelength of 610 nm, Beer’s law is obeyed over the range of 0.1 ~ 4.0 μ g / mL for nickel content and the apparent molar absorption coefficient of method is ε 610 nm = 1.13 × 104 L. mol-1.cm-1. This method has been applied to the determination of nickel in kelp.
